Suppression of human immunodeficiency virus type 1 viral load during acute measles.

William J Moss1, Susana Scott, Zaza Ndhlovu, Mwaka Monze, Felicity T Cutts, Thomas C Quinn, Diane E Griffin.   

Abstract

Acute measles virus infection can result in a transient decrease in plasma human immunodeficiency virus type 1 (HIV-1) RNA loads. We report the kinetics of plasma HIV-1 RNA loads in 2 Zambian children with confirmed and probable measles, and show that the decline in viral load is of similar magnitude to the first-phase decay rate after initiation of antiretroviral therapy.
